Can't open the Fitbit app from my iPhone

Replies are disabled for this topic. Start a new one or visit our Help Center.

After the update I am unable to open my app from my iPhone home screen. I have to go into the App Store and find FitBit then click open from there. Everything else on my phone is up to date, I’ve restarted everything, and synced etc. Is this an update bug?

Hello there @Syemyim, thanks for stopping by and for the details provided about what you're experiencing when trying to access to your Fitbit app. 

 

The issue where some customers who update to iOS 13.5 see the error message: “This app is no longer shared with you, to use it, you must buy it from the App store." has now been resolved. Please make sure your app (Version 3.21) and OS are updated to the latest versions. We appreciate you coming to the Forums to report the problem. 😉
